首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在多个Google日历之间同步可用性?

在多个Google日历之间同步可用性,可以通过以下步骤实现:

  1. 使用Google Calendar API:Google提供了Calendar API,可以通过该API访问和管理用户的日历数据。首先,需要创建一个Google Cloud项目,并启用Calendar API。然后,使用API提供的身份验证机制获取访问令牌和密钥。
  2. 获取日历列表:使用Calendar API中的"calendarList.list"方法获取用户的日历列表。该方法返回一个包含所有日历的列表,包括主日历和共享的日历。
  3. 选择要同步的日历:根据需求选择要同步的日历。可以根据日历的ID或其他属性进行筛选。
  4. 同步日历事件:使用Calendar API中的"events.list"方法获取选定日历的事件列表。可以指定时间范围和其他筛选条件。获取到事件列表后,可以将其存储在本地数据库或其他存储介质中。
  5. 定期更新事件:为了保持日历的同步,需要定期更新事件列表。可以使用定时任务或其他调度机制,定期调用"events.list"方法获取最新的事件列表,并与本地存储的事件进行比较和更新。
  6. 处理冲突和重复事件:在同步过程中,可能会出现冲突和重复的事件。可以根据业务需求制定相应的策略来处理这些情况。例如,可以选择保留最新的事件或合并冲突的事件。
  7. 提供用户界面:为了方便用户管理和监控日历同步,可以开发一个用户界面。该界面可以提供日历选择、同步设置、冲突处理等功能。

推荐的腾讯云相关产品:腾讯云提供了丰富的云计算产品和服务,其中包括云服务器、云数据库、云存储等。对于日历同步应用,可以考虑使用腾讯云的云函数(Serverless)服务来实现定期更新事件的功能。云函数可以根据设定的触发器定时执行代码,非常适合处理定时任务。

产品介绍链接地址:腾讯云云函数

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

何在多个MySQL实例之间进行数据同步和复制

多个MySQL实例之间进行数据同步和复制是一项关键的任务,它可以确保数据的一致性和可靠性。下面将详细介绍如何实现MySQL实例之间的数据同步和复制。...这种复制方式提供了最低的延迟,但主节点和从节点之间的网络连接必须稳定。 2)、异步复制: 主节点将写操作记录到二进制日志,然后异步地传输给从节点进行应用。...5、实现高可用性 为了实现高可用性,可以采取以下措施: 1)、使用主从节点集群: 通过将多个主节点和多个从节点组成集群,实现数据的水平扩展和故障容错。...在多个MySQL实例之间进行数据同步和复制是保证数据一致性和可靠性的重要任务。通过正确配置和管理,可以实现数据在主节点和从节点之间的自动同步,提高系统的可用性和性能。...同时,需要进行监控和故障处理,以及实现高可用性的措施,确保系统的稳定和可靠运行。

47310

跨平台日历同步:使用 CalDAV 和 Radicale 打造个人日历云服务

iOS 的系统日历中想要查看 Feishu 和 Google 日历都还是比较简单的,在 设置 - 账户 中,添加账户或者订阅日历就可以。...以下是参考文档: Add Google Calendar events to Apple Calendar - iPhone & iPad - Google Calendar Help 个人用户如何设置本地系统日历到飞书日历的单向同步...CalDAV的主要作用包括: 跨设备和应用程序同步日历数据:CalDAV 协议使得用户能够在多个设备(手机、平板和电脑)和不同的日历应用程序之间同步日历数据,从而实现统一的日程管理。...多用户日历共享和协作:CalDAV 支持多用户之间日历共享,允许多用户查看和编辑彼此的日程安排,便于提升协作效率。...与现有的日历应用程序兼容:许多流行的日历应用程序, Google Calendar、Apple Calendar 和 Microsoft Outlook 等,都支持 CalDAV 协议。

6.1K20
  • ONLYOFFICE 文档 8.1 现已发布:功能全面的 PDF 编辑器、幻灯片版式、优化电子表格的协作等等

    它还与多种第三方服务集成,Google Drive、Dropbox、OneDrive等,用户可以方便地在不同平台和设备间同步文件。...示例: 以下是一个简单的 JavaScript 示例,展示如何在网页中嵌入 ONLYOFFICE 编辑器: <!...合并和拆分 PDF: 用户可以将多个 PDF 文件合并为一个或将一个 PDF 文件拆分为多个,方便文档管理。...集成与兼容性 第三方集成: ONLYOFFICE 8.1 的 PDF 编辑器可以与其他云存储服务( Google Drive、Dropbox、OneDrive)集成,方便用户在不同平台间同步和管理文件...以下是关于无缝切换模式的详细介绍: 文档编辑模式 实时协作编辑: 多个用户可以同时编辑同一文档,实时同步更改,支持协作编辑和即时通讯功能,使团队能够在同一文档上进行有效的协作。

    15710

    苹果iCloud架构的关键组成

    用户可以在不同设备上访问相同的照片、文档、联系人、日历等信息,提高数据的可用性和用户体验的一致性。 2....去中心化与便捷性:iCloud旨在减少对物理连接(iTunes)的依赖,让用户能够无线地管理和访问数据,提高了数据管理的灵活性和便捷性。 4....应对市场竞争:面对Amazon、Google等竞争对手推出的云服务,iCloud是苹果的战略回应,旨在保持其在数字内容存储与服务领域的竞争力。...- 数据分片与复制:采用数据分片技术将用户数据切分为更小的部分,并在多个节点上复制存储,提高数据的可靠性及访问速度。这也有助于应对大规模用户请求和数据恢复需求。 2....- Web界面:通过iCloud.com,用户还可以访问和管理存储在云端的数据,包括邮件、联系人、日历、照片等。

    15810

    ClickHouse集群的高可用性和负载均衡,以及数据复制和同步技术

    使用一个负载均衡器(Nginx、HAProxy等),将所有的查询请求分发到多个ClickHouse节点上,从而均衡查询的负载。ClickHouse本身也支持内部负载均衡功能。...您可以配置多个副本表,每个副本表包含多个副本,每个副本分布在不同的节点上。当执行查询时,ClickHouse会自动选择合适的副本进行查询,并将结果返回给客户端。如何设置自动故障转移以确保高可用性?...ClickHouse集群的数据复制和同步技术数据复制和同步方面的问题如何在多个ClickHouse集群之间进行数据复制和同步?是否支持异步或同步复制?异步和同步复制的优缺点是什么?...回答在多个ClickHouse集群之间进行数据复制和同步可以使用多种方法,使用ClickHouse的内置功能或使用第三方工具。...调整复制策略,更改复制频率或复制优先级,以适应网络延迟和带宽限制。

    1.5K41

    多主复制的适用场景(2)-需离线操作的客户端和协作编辑

    手机、PC和其他设备上的日历应用。无论设备当前是否连网,都需随时查看: 当前会议日程(读请求) 添加新会议(写请求) 离线状态下进行的任何更改,会在设备下次上线时,与服务器和其他设备同步。...此时,每个设备都有一个充当M的本地DB(接受写请求),并在所有设备之间采用异步方式同步这些多M上的副本,同步滞后可能是几h或数天,具体时间取决于设备何时再联网。...架构上,这种设置类似IDC之间的多主复制,只不过每个设备都是个“IDC”,而它们之间的网络连接极不可靠。从日历同步功能的这些破烂实现也能看出,多主可以得到结果,但中间依旧很多未知数。...有一些工具就是为了使多主配置更容易,CouchDB。 3.1.3 协作编辑 实时协作编辑应用程序允许多人同时编辑文档。Google Docs。

    39240

    Web 认证机制相关概念解析

    在 Web 开发中,我们经常会遇到各种各样的认证机制的概念和名词, Cookies、Session、Token、SSO(Single Sign-On)和 OAuth 2.0 等,下面详细解释一下它们之间的联系与异同...例如,Google 的各种服务( Gmail、Google Drive、Google Photos 等)就使用了 SSO。...例如,用户在使用一个日历应用时,可能需要访问他在 Google 日历上的数据。...这时,用户可以通过 OAuth 2.0 获取 Google 日历的授权 token,然后将这个 token 授权给日历应用,日历应用就可以使用这个 token 来获取 Google 日历的数据。...与 Cookies/Session/Token 只能在单个应用中保存用户状态不同,SSO 允许用户在多个应用之间共享认证状态,用户只需要登录一次,就可以访问所有连接的应用。

    12910

    全网对CAP最深层的思考

    因此CAP三者不可兼得,变成如何在C(一致性)、A(可用性)二者进行抉择,可以举个例子来说明:在分布式环境中,为了确保系统可用性,通常会采用将数据复制到多个备份节点,而复制的过程需要通过网络交互。...在网络分区恢复后,完成数据同步。 实践中,怎么应用CAP? CAP描述的一致性和可用性,都是100%的强度。...在生产实践中,我们并不需要100%的一致性和可用性,因此我们需要对一致性和可用性之间进行权衡,选择CP架构或者AP架构。...所以我们认为ZooKeeper在关键时刻选择一致性,但是它仍拥有很高的可用性。 2017 年,Google 公司的第一代 Spanner 系统已经诞生。...eureka集群正常运行时,各节点之间可以正常通讯、保持心跳、复制数据,以此保持数据的一致性。但发生网络分区时,eureka确实选择了可用性,而放弃了一致性。

    48620

    Google Workspace发布「开会」神器:每个员工可以省11000美元!

    Google Workspace包括了云计算、生产力和协作相关的工具、软件和产品,涵盖了Gmail, Google 硬盘、日历、文档等软件,这些产品都可以免费试用,但如果需要高级解决方案需要额外付费(例如...还有用于内容审核和管理空间的工具,以及定期或按日历中的分段工作时间为每个工作日设置位置的功能。...One Board 65、Series One Desk 27和其他Meet硬件产品组合以及 Webex Room系列、Room Kit系列、Desk 系列和Board系列都将支持Meet 和 Webex之间的呼叫互操作性...随着一些人开始返回办公室,团队需要随时随地灵活协作的能力,在 Google的客户中,最大的问题就是:如何在混合的工作环境中让各位同事保持信息同步、做出决策并建立团队文化。...而Meet这次的更新则主要针对弥合虚拟协作和面对面协作之间的差别,有条件的同学可以现在就开始体验Workspace啦,可以为你的同事、队友共享信息、推进项目和建立交流社区。

    96920

    谷歌悄悄上线新应用,欲用“Switch to Android”吸引苹果用户

    苹果此举让 Google 如鲠在喉,因而 Google 为拉拢苹果用户,使苹果用户能够轻松切换到安卓系统,近日在美国等部分全球市场的 App Store 上悄悄上线了一款新应用——“Switch to...预期所料,“Switch to Android”应用可以通过帮助用户将他们的联系人、照片和视频等数据导入新的 Android 手机,使移动平台之间的过渡更容易管理。...选择所要复制转移的内容,包括联系人、日历、照片以及视频。...最后,即是将你的 iCloud 数据转移到 Google Drive/Google Photos 中。...然而,虽然 iOS 方面已准备就绪,但 Android 的设置和恢复过程似乎还没有完全为 Switch to Android 的可用性做好准备。

    59810

    【技术探索】手机上人工助理是如何实现的?

    对Siri来说,Safari里浏览记录根本无法获取,如果你真的在意自己的隐私,那么千万别在Safari上使用Google账号登陆。 日历 ? 人类助理需要日历,人工助理也需要日历。...Google会时刻「监控」你日历(当然也是Google 日历)的变化,任何一件事都会成为Google Now预测数据。...Cortana也做一样的事情,它在Windows系统中随时检测日历变化,不过到了Android系统,则无法读取日历数据,考虑到Windows手机的普及率,咳咳… Siri对于日历数据也非常重要。...它能读取iOS系统日历的事件,哪怕这个日历是来自Google日历同步数据。 位置 ? 在我看来,日历构成了人工助理最重要的数据来源。...Siri 的做法有点独特,Siri会收集你在多个地方的位置数据,从而自动判断并预测一些事情。

    90080

    Java并发Map的面试指南:线程安全数据结构的奥秘

    多个线程同时访问和修改共享数据时,很容易出现各种问题,竞态条件和数据不一致性。...Google Guava库中的ConcurrentMap Google Guava库提供了一个名为MapMaker的工具,用于创建高性能的并发Map。...分布式Map的挑战 分布式并发Map面临一些挑战,包括: 一致性和可用性: 在分布式环境中,维护数据的一致性和可用性是一项艰巨的任务。...分布式系统需要解决网络分区、故障恢复和数据同步等问题,以确保数据的正确性和可用性。 性能: 分布式Map需要在不同节点之间传输数据,这可能会引入网络延迟。...尽量减少多个线程之间的共享数据,而是将数据不可变化或限制在需要同步的最小范围内。这将有助于减少竞态条件和数据不一致性的可能性。 总结 本文深入探讨了并发Map的概念、实现和性能优化策略。

    16120

    零基础入门分布式系统 7.3 Eventual consistency

    另一部分代价是可扩展性:所有更新都需要通过一个领导者来排序,Raft,领导者可能成为一个瓶颈,限制了每秒钟可以处理的操作数量。...作为一个例子,你可以在大多数手机、平板电脑和电脑上找到的日历应用程序。我们希望这个应用中的预约和安排能在所有设备上同步;换句话说,我们希望它能被复制,使每个设备都是一个副本。...他们可以在稍后的某个有网的时候,在设备之间同步更新。...这种trade-off权衡被称为CAP定理(consistency一致性,availability可用性,partition tolerance 分区容忍度):如果一个系统中有一个网络分区,我们必须在以下两者中选择一个...FLP不可能原理向我们表明,共识和全序广播需要部分同步。可以证明,一个线性一致的CAS操作等同于共识[Herlihy, 1991],因此也需要部分同步

    56810

    数据一致性:核心概念与实现策略

    因此,如何在分布式系统中保持数据一致性,是分布式系统设计中的一个重要问题。 2、数据一致性模型 数据一致性模型是分布式系统中的重要概念,它决定了数据在多个节点之间如何保持一致。...这意味着,如果有多个副本存在,那么在更新操作时,所有的副本必须同步更新。 强一致性的优点是提供了非常直观和简单的编程模型,因为所有的操作者都看到了同样的数据视图,不需要处理数据不一致的问题。...CP without A:如果不要求 A(可用),相当于每个请求都需要在 Server 之间强一致,而 P(分区)会导致同步时间无限延长,如此CP 也是可以保证的。...而 BASE 则提供了一种最终一致性的模型,适用于对可用性要求非常高的场景,互联网应用。在实际的系统设计中,需要根据系统的需求和特点,权衡一致性和可用性之间的关系,选择合适的设计理论。...---- 5、一致性方案的现状与展望 5.1、实际应用案例 以下是一些大型互联网公司在他们的分布式系统中保证数据一致性的实际应用案例: Google 的 Bigtable:Bigtable 是 Google

    1.4K32

    从谷歌 20 年的站点可靠性工程(SRE)中学到的 11 个经验教训

    大约在同一时间段,比 YouTube 稍微年轻的兄弟公司谷歌日历Google Calendar)也经历了宕机故障,这也是接下来两个经验教训的背景。 4....团队希望能够使用 Google Hangouts 和 Google Meet 来管理事件。但当 3.5 亿用户退出他们的设备和服务时……回想起来,依赖这些谷歌服务是一个糟糕的决定。...故意降级性能模式 人们很容易将可用性视为“完全启动”或“完全关闭”……但是能够通过降级性能模式提供连续的最小功能有助于提供更一致的用户体验。...下一个经验教训建议我们确保最后一道防线系统在极端情况下能预期的那样工作,例如自然灾害或网络攻击,这些情况会导致生产力或服务可用性的损失。 8....自动化故障削减措施 2023 年 3 月,几个数据中心的多个网络设备几乎同时发生故障,导致大范围的数据包丢失。

    25640

    分布式系统理论基础2 :CAP

    本系列文章将整理到我在GitHub上的《Java面试指南》仓库,更多精彩内容请到我的仓库里查看 https://github.com/h2pl/Java-Tutorial 喜欢的话麻烦点下Star哈 本文也将同步到我的个人博客...延时与数据一致性也是一对“冤家”,如果要达到强一致性、多个副本数据一致,必然增加延时。...加上延时的考量,我们得到一个CAP理论的修改版本PACELC[17]:如果出现P(网络分区),如何在A(服务可用性)、C(数据一致性)之间选择;否则,如何在L(延时)、C(数据一致性)之间选择。...CAP理论对分布式系统实现有非常重大的影响,我们可以根据自身的业务特点,在数据一致性和服务可用性之间作出倾向性地选择。...通过放松约束条件,我们可以实现在不同时间点满足CAP(此CAP非CAP定理中的CAP,C替换为最终一致性)[18][19][20]。

    48710

    Java并发Map的面试指南:线程安全数据结构的奥秘

    多个线程同时访问和修改共享数据时,很容易出现各种问题,竞态条件和数据不一致性。...另外,还有一些第三方库,Caffeine和Ehcache,提供了高性能的缓存和并发Map功能。...分布式Map的挑战分布式并发Map面临一些挑战,包括:一致性和可用性: 在分布式环境中,维护数据的一致性和可用性是一项艰巨的任务。...分布式系统需要解决网络分区、故障恢复和数据同步等问题,以确保数据的正确性和可用性。性能: 分布式Map需要在不同节点之间传输数据,这可能会引入网络延迟。...尽量减少多个线程之间的共享数据,而是将数据不可变化或限制在需要同步的最小范围内。这将有助于减少竞态条件和数据不一致性的可能性。总结本文深入探讨了并发Map的概念、实现和性能优化策略。

    34460

    分布式一致性协议 - CAP、BASE、NWR

    我们追求的应该是用户感知的可用性,CAP中可用性和一致性给我们只是起到指导性的作用。 2017 年,Google 公司的第一代 Spanner 系统已经诞生。...即允许节点之间数据同步存在延时 最终一致性(Eventually Consistent):本质是指系统需要使数据最终达到一致性,而不需要实时使数据达到一致性 ACID科普 对于ACID中一致性描述,可能理解都不一样...因此CAP三者不可兼得,变成如何在C(一致性)、A(可用性)二者进行抉择,可以举个例子来说明:在分布式环境中,为了确保系统可用性,通常会采用将数据复制到多个备份节点,而复制的过程需要通过网络交互。...ACID解决的是多个事务并发下,保证数据准确性。 AP和BASE都是对可用性的研究,BASE要求的只是基本可用,而AP对一致性的要求更低,所以能保证的可用性更高。...ACID与CP区别 ACID解决的问题是数据库系统中并发执行多个事务时的问题,是数据库领域的传统问题。那么多个事务并发会存在哪些问题?

    1.5K31

    SRE学习笔记:分布式共识系统、Paxos协议

    最近阅读了《SRE Google运维解密》的第23章,有一些感触,记录一下。 日常工作中,我们经常需要一些服务分布式的运行。...跨区域跨城、跨洲部署运行分布式系统往往是容易的,但是如何保证各系统间状态的一致是困难的。...同时由于现实环境中,网络分区问题迟早会发生(光纤断、延时、丢包等问题),构建分布式系统就需要在高可用和一致性之间选择。...软状态:和硬状态相对,是指允许系统中的数据存在中间状态,并认为该中间状态的存在不会影响系统的整体可用性,即允许系统在不同节点的数据副本之间进行数据同步的过程存在延时。...可靠的复制状态机 RSM (replicated state machine) 是一个能在多个进程中用同样顺序执行同样的一组操作的系统。

    60710
    领券